Ansicht
Dokumentation

C14ALE_SUB_REPLICATE - EHS: Anforderung zum Replizieren von Stoffdaten

C14ALE_SUB_REPLICATE - EHS: Anforderung zum Replizieren von Stoffdaten

BAL Application Log Documentation   RFUMSV00 - Advance Return for Tax on Sales/Purchases  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ität aus der Sicht des Aufrufers

Die Methode REPLICATE wird verwendet, um in einem System Kopien von Instanzen des Businessobjekts Stoff per ALE zu versenden. Dabei können über den Baustein sowohl im Push-Verfahren Stoffdaten angefordert, als auch im Pull-Verfahren Stoffe verteilt werden.

Im Zusammenspiel mit der Methode SAVEREPLICAMULTIPLE werden die bereitgestellten Instanzen anschließend im Zielsystem gespeichert.

Die Verteilung erfolgt asynchron.

Schnittstelle

Eingabe
KEY_DATE
Selektionsdatum für die Selektion der zu verteilenden Stoffe.
SUBSTANCE
Stoffschlüssel für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
SUBLIST
Stoffliste für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
ID_TYPE
Identifikatortyp für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
ID_CATEGRY
Identifikatorart für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
IDENTIFIER
Identifikator für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
MATERIAL
Materialnummer für die Selektion der zu verteilenden Stoffe. Es können Wildcards verwendet werden.
SUBSTANCELIST
Liste von Stoffen, die verteilt werden sollen. Ist dieser Parameter mit Einträgen angegeben, dann wird keine Suche durchgeführt.
SAVEREPLICARECIPIENTS
Dieser Parameter identifiziert die logischen Systeme, in denen die Stoffobjekte repliziert werden sollen. Ist dieser Parameter auf "initial" gesetzt, findet die Ermittlung der Empfängersysteme über das ALE-Verteilungsmodell statt.
Ausgabe
RETURN_TAB
Fehlermeldungen, die während des Startes der Versendung von Stoffdaten aufgetreten sind. Weitere Fehlermeldungen sind dem ALE-Monitoring zu entnehmen.

Sonstiges

Grobe Beschreibung der Ablauflogik

Vorbedingungen

ALE-Verteilungsmodell muß gepflegt sein, wenn die
Empfängerermittlung über den Baustein gemacht werden soll.

Ablauf

Allgemeine Berechtigungsprüfung (C_SHES_TRH, 59, "Verteilen")
Bestimmung der Stoffe, die zu verteilen sind
Für jeden zu verteilenden Stoff ist folgendes durchzuführen:
ALE-Empfängerermittlung durchführen, falls Empfänger nicht als Parameter angegeben.
Stoffdaten mittels BAPI lesen (mit Berechtigungsprüfung)
Zu Stoffreferenzierungen (ESTRR und ESTVP) die Stoffschlüssel lesen und eintragen.
Ankreuzleisten setzen (alles gesetzt außer Verwaltungsfelder)
Verteilung anstoßen durch den Aufruf des generierten Funktionsbausteins ALE_BUS1077_SAVREPMUL.

Nachbedingungen

Für die angegebenen Stoffe ist die asynchrone Verteilung der Stoffdaten gestartet.

mögliche Ausnahmen

keine

Beispiel

-

Hinweise zur Wartung des Bausteines

-

Weiterführende Informationen

Spezifikation EH&S - ALE
BAPI-Programmierleitfaden
ALE-Programmierleitfaden

Hinweise zu SAPscript





Parameter

E_RETURN_TAB
I_IDENTIFIER
I_IDENTIFIER_CATEGORY
I_IDENTIFIER_TYPE
I_KEY_DATE
I_MATERIAL
I_MATERIAL_LONG
I_SAVEREPLICARECIPIENTS_TAB
I_SUBLIST
I_SUBSTANCE
I_SUBSTANCELIST_TAB

Ausnahmen

Funktionsgruppe

C14ALE

RFUMSV00 - Advance Return for Tax on Sales/Purchases   CPI1466 during Backup  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 4855 Date: 20240523 Time: 144316     sap01-206 ( 62 ms )